Overview of the 2.0 16V Ecotec Engine
The 2.0 16V Ecotec engine, part of the Ecotec family, was designed by Opel to provide a blend of performance and efficiency. It’s a four-cylinder, 16-valve engine that incorporates modern technologies for its time, such as multi-point fuel injection and a robust engine management system. This engine aimed to deliver a smooth and responsive driving experience, making it a favorite among Astra G owners. The Ecotec engine is engineered to minimize emissions while maximizing power output. Its design reflects Opel's commitment to creating environmentally conscious yet powerful engines. The engine's architecture includes an aluminum cylinder head and a cast-iron block, balancing weight and durability. The multi-point fuel injection system ensures precise fuel delivery, improving combustion efficiency and reducing fuel consumption. Furthermore, the engine management system continuously monitors and adjusts various parameters, such as ignition timing and fuel mixture, to optimize performance under different driving conditions. This advanced control contributes to the engine's responsiveness and overall efficiency. The 2.0 16V Ecotec engine also features a relatively high compression ratio, which enhances thermal efficiency and power output. The 16-valve configuration allows for better airflow into and out of the cylinders, further improving performance. All these features combined make the 2.0 16V Ecotec engine a well-rounded and reliable choice for the Opel Astra G, offering a good balance of power, efficiency, and durability.
Engine Specifications
Understanding the specifications of the 2.0 16V Ecotec engine can provide insights into its capabilities. Typically, this engine produces around 136 horsepower (101 kW) and approximately 188 Nm of torque. It has a displacement of 1998cc and a compression ratio that enhances its efficiency. These specifications mean that the Astra G equipped with this engine can offer decent acceleration and a comfortable driving experience, whether you're cruising on the highway or navigating city streets. The engine's bore and stroke are designed to optimize both power and torque delivery across a wide RPM range. The 16-valve configuration ensures that each cylinder receives an adequate supply of air and fuel, enhancing combustion efficiency and power output. The multi-point fuel injection system precisely meters the fuel, contributing to the engine's smooth operation and reduced emissions. Moreover, the engine's lightweight components, such as the aluminum cylinder head, help to improve its overall performance by reducing inertia. The engine's design also includes features that minimize friction, further enhancing its efficiency and longevity. These specifications reflect Opel's engineering efforts to create an engine that is both powerful and reliable, suitable for a wide range of driving conditions. The 2.0 16V Ecotec engine's performance figures make it a competitive choice in its class, providing a satisfying balance of power, efficiency, and durability for Opel Astra G owners.
Common Issues and Problems
Like any engine, the 2.0 16V Ecotec is not immune to issues. Some common problems include oil leaks, particularly around the valve cover gasket and oil pan. Another issue is related to the engine's sensors, such as the oxygen sensor or crankshaft position sensor, which can sometimes fail and cause performance problems. Additionally, some owners have reported issues with the engine's cooling system, leading to overheating.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more significant damage and maintain the engine's performance. Oil leaks, if left unattended, can lead to low oil levels and potential engine damage. Regularly checking and replacing gaskets can help prevent these leaks. Sensor failures can cause a variety of symptoms, including poor fuel economy, rough idling, and reduced power. Diagnosing and replacing faulty sensors can restore the engine's performance and efficiency. Cooling system problems, such as a failing water pump or a clogged radiator, can cause the engine to overheat, potentially leading to severe damage. Regularly inspecting and maintaining the cooling system can help prevent these issues. It's also important to use the correct type of coolant and to flush the system periodically to remove any deposits. By being aware of these common issues and addressing them promptly, owners can ensure the long-term reliability and performance of their 2.0 16V Ecotec engine.
Maintenance Tips for Longevity
To keep your 2.0 16V Ecotec engine running smoothly for years, regular maintenance is essential. This includes following the manufacturer's recommended service intervals for oil changes, filter replacements, and spark plug replacements. It's also important to check and maintain the engine's cooling system, including regular coolant flushes. Additionally, keep an eye on the engine's belts and hoses, replacing them as needed to prevent breakdowns. By following these maintenance tips, you can extend the life of your engine and avoid costly repairs. Regular oil changes are crucial for keeping the engine's internal components lubricated and free from deposits. Using the correct type of oil and filter is essential for optimal performance and protection. Replacing the air and fuel filters regularly ensures that the engine receives clean air and fuel, improving its efficiency and reducing emissions. Spark plugs should be inspected and replaced according to the manufacturer's recommendations to maintain proper ignition and combustion. The cooling system should be flushed periodically to remove any deposits and prevent overheating. Belts and hoses should be inspected for signs of wear and tear and replaced as needed to prevent breakdowns. By following these maintenance tips diligently, owners can ensure the long-term reliability and performance of their 2.0 16V Ecotec engine, keeping their Opel Astra G running smoothly for years to come.

Upgrades and Modifications
For those looking to enhance the performance of their 2.0 16V Ecotec engine, there are several upgrades and modifications available. These range from simple bolt-on modifications to more extensive engine work. Some popular upgrades include performance air filters, exhaust systems, and ECU remapping. These modifications can improve the engine's horsepower, torque, and throttle response, making the Astra G even more enjoyable to drive. However, it's essential to choose upgrades carefully and ensure they are compatible with the engine and vehicle. Performance air filters can improve airflow to the engine, increasing horsepower and throttle response. Exhaust systems can reduce backpressure, further enhancing power output. ECU remapping can optimize the engine's performance by adjusting parameters such as ignition timing and fuel mixture. More extensive engine work, such as upgrading the camshafts or increasing the compression ratio, can yield even greater performance gains, but these modifications require more expertise and investment. It's important to consult with a qualified mechanic before making any significant modifications to ensure they are done correctly and safely. Additionally, be aware that some modifications may affect the vehicle's emissions compliance and warranty. By carefully selecting and installing upgrades, enthusiasts can unlock even more potential from their 2.0 16V Ecotec engine, transforming their Opel Astra G into a true performance machine.
